Turn It off!!
Now that spring is here and the weather is getting warmer by the day, what better time is there to celebrate National T.V. Turnoff Week? The point of this brain-energizing week is to raise awareness of the harmful effects of excessive television exposure, and to encourage people to replace TV time with more productive activities. Reducing the amount of time you spend watching television can lead to a more literate and stimulating life.
While you give your brain a break from the boob tube this week, spend your free time discovering new hobbies. You'll be pleasantly surprised by how many other exciting activities there are to replace your favorite TV shows. Try playing a few holes of golf or toss the football around with your friends and family. After all, spending time indoors watching TV is a crying shame when you've got beautiful spring weather to keep you healthy and active!
